The Best Guide To How To Become A Machine Learning Engineer - Exponent thumbnail
"

The Best Guide To How To Become A Machine Learning Engineer - Exponent

Published Feb 06, 25
5 min read


Santiago: I am from Cuba. Alexey: Okay. Santiago: Yeah.

I went through my Master's right here in the States. Alexey: Yeah, I believe I saw this online. I assume in this picture that you shared from Cuba, it was 2 people you and your friend and you're gazing at the computer system.

Santiago: I believe the first time we saw web throughout my college level, I assume it was 2000, maybe 2001, was the first time that we obtained accessibility to web. Back then it was concerning having a pair of publications and that was it.

The Basic Principles Of How To Become A Machine Learning Engineer



Actually anything that you want to understand is going to be on the internet in some kind. Alexey: Yeah, I see why you enjoy publications. Santiago: Oh, yeah.

Among the hardest abilities for you to get and begin giving worth in the machine learning area is coding your ability to establish services your capacity to make the computer system do what you want. That is among the most popular abilities that you can build. If you're a software program engineer, if you currently have that skill, you're certainly midway home.

The smart Trick of 19 Machine Learning Bootcamps & Classes To Know That Nobody is Discussing

It's interesting that lots of people are worried of math. But what I've seen is that many individuals that don't proceed, the ones that are left behind it's not due to the fact that they do not have mathematics skills, it's due to the fact that they lack coding skills. If you were to ask "Who's better placed to be successful?" 9 breaks of 10, I'm gon na pick the person who currently understands how to develop software program and supply worth via software.

Absolutely. (8:05) Alexey: They simply need to persuade themselves that mathematics is not the most awful. (8:07) Santiago: It's not that scary. It's not that scary. Yeah, mathematics you're mosting likely to need mathematics. And yeah, the deeper you go, math is gon na become more crucial. But it's not that frightening. I assure you, if you have the skills to develop software program, you can have a significant effect simply with those abilities and a little bit more mathematics that you're going to integrate as you go.



How do I convince myself that it's not terrifying? That I shouldn't bother with this thing? (8:36) Santiago: A terrific concern. Number one. We need to think of that's chairing device discovering web content mainly. If you think of it, it's mostly originating from academic community. It's documents. It's the individuals who created those solutions that are creating guides and taping YouTube video clips.

I have the hope that that's going to obtain far better with time. (9:17) Santiago: I'm dealing with it. A bunch of people are working with it attempting to share the opposite side of artificial intelligence. It is an extremely different technique to comprehend and to discover just how to make progression in the area.

Believe about when you go to institution and they educate you a lot of physics and chemistry and math. Just since it's a general structure that perhaps you're going to require later.

Unknown Facts About Machine Learning Engineers:requirements - Vault

You can know very, very reduced degree details of how it works internally. Or you may recognize simply the needed points that it carries out in order to address the problem. Not every person that's utilizing sorting a list now recognizes specifically how the algorithm works. I understand extremely effective Python developers that don't even understand that the arranging behind Python is called Timsort.

They can still sort checklists, right? Now, some various other individual will inform you, "Yet if something fails with sort, they will not be sure of why." When that takes place, they can go and dive much deeper and get the knowledge that they need to recognize exactly how group type functions. But I don't believe every person needs to begin from the nuts and screws of the material.

Santiago: That's things like Vehicle ML is doing. They're supplying tools that you can make use of without needing to know the calculus that goes on behind the scenes. I assume that it's a different approach and it's something that you're gon na see more and more of as time goes on. Alexey: Likewise, to include in your example of understanding sorting just how numerous times does it occur that your sorting algorithm doesn't work? Has it ever happened to you that arranging really did not function? (12:13) Santiago: Never ever, no.



I'm claiming it's a spectrum. How much you understand regarding sorting will absolutely assist you. If you understand much more, it might be useful for you. That's all right. Yet you can not restrict people just due to the fact that they don't know things like type. You must not restrict them on what they can achieve.

As an example, I have actually been uploading a great deal of material on Twitter. The strategy that usually I take is "Just how much lingo can I remove from this content so even more individuals understand what's occurring?" So if I'm going to discuss something allow's claim I simply published a tweet recently concerning ensemble learning.

My obstacle is how do I remove all of that and still make it accessible to more individuals? They recognize the scenarios where they can utilize it.

More About What Is The Best Route Of Becoming An Ai Engineer?



I assume that's a good thing. (13:00) Alexey: Yeah, it's a great thing that you're doing on Twitter, because you have this capability to put complicated points in easy terms. And I concur with whatever you say. To me, often I feel like you can review my mind and simply tweet it out.

Since I agree with nearly every little thing you claim. This is amazing. Many thanks for doing this. Exactly how do you really tackle eliminating this jargon? Despite the fact that it's not incredibly pertaining to the subject today, I still believe it's fascinating. Complicated things like set learning How do you make it available for individuals? (14:02) Santiago: I think this goes much more into blogging about what I do.

You understand what, occasionally you can do it. It's always regarding attempting a little bit harder obtain comments from the people who read the content.